Yugoslavia, Socialist Federal Republic of
Practice Relating to Rule 145. Reprisals
Section D. Order at the highest authority of government
The Socialist Federal Republic of Yugoslavia’s Military Manual (1988) states: “The armed forces of the SFRY [Socialist Federal Republic of Yugoslavia] shall undertake reprisals against the enemy … only by order of a commander who is competent to determine reprisals.”
In another provision, the manual specifies that reprisals must be ordered by a competent commander (corps commander and equal or higher rank responsible for the sector in which the violation of the adversary took place), except when a commander of a lesser rank cannot establish contact with higher command. Reprisals against an entire enemy force can only be ordered by the Supreme Command.
